The Best Renovations Know What to Keep — and What to Rethink
A whole-home renovation does not always require changing everything.
Interior Conception evaluates the existing residence to understand which elements can remain, which should be refined, and which are preventing the home from functioning or feeling cohesive.
That may include reconsidering room relationships, widening or relocating openings, redesigning a kitchen or primary suite, improving storage, updating fireplaces and built-ins, revising lighting and ceiling conditions, or creating a more consistent material language between renovated and existing spaces.
The design direction is developed around the realities of the home so new work feels intentional rather than disconnected from what remains.
